The Rolex Submariner. The name itself evokes images of underwater exploration, rugged durability, and unparalleled luxury. Since its launch in 1953, this iconic timepiece has cemented its place as not just a diving instrument, but a symbol of status and enduring style. At its launch in 1953, the Rolex Submariner was groundbreaking. It was the first diver's wristwatch to be water-resistant to a depth of 100 meters (330 feet), a significant leap forward in horological technology. This revolutionary waterproofness, achieved through a meticulously engineered case and crown system, ensured reliable performance even under extreme pressure. This initial water resistance, while impressive for its time, has been continuously improved upon throughout the Submariner's evolution, reaching depths far exceeding the original specification in modern iterations. This commitment to pushing boundaries is a hallmark of Rolex and a key factor in the enduring success of the Submariner.

Rolex Submariner Gold Watch: A Spectrum of Elegance

The Rolex Submariner gold watch encompasses a wide range of models, each with its own distinct characteristics and appeal. The most common is the yellow gold Submariner, a classic representation of opulence and sophistication. The warm, rich hue of the yellow gold case complements the dark dial, creating a striking contrast that is both elegant and assertive. The yellow gold Submariner often features a distinctive bezel, usually in either yellow gold or a contrasting ceramic material, further enhancing its luxurious appeal.

Beyond yellow gold, Rolex has also produced Submariners in white gold and rose gold. The white gold versions offer a more understated elegance, with a cool, silvery sheen that is both sophisticated and modern. Rose gold, a more recent addition to the Submariner family, brings a warmer, more romantic tone to the iconic design. The subtle variations in colour and tone allow for a personalized choice, ensuring that there is a gold Submariner to suit every individual taste and preference.
